Unijobs on behalf of the HSE are currently recruiting for the position of Grade VII Data Analyst, the ideal candidate will have previous experience with ETL tools such as Databricks, SQL, SSAS, SSIS, ADF etc.. The successful candidate will have a working week of 35 hours Monday to Friday and the candidate must be available to start immediately. The salary for this post will be €53,121.

There are 3 core elements to this role;

  • Fulfilling the role of a Technical Lead
  • Data Analysis
  • Team Leadership & Management



  • Fulfilling the role of a Technical Lead


The Data Analyst fulfils the role of the Technical Lead for one or more work streams of activity occurring within the Data Services team. They work alongside Project Managers and a diverse team of skilled colleagues to deliver data solutions.

The Technical Leads of work streams are accountable for the architecture, design, quality, stability and resiliency of the solutions their work streams are delivering. They play a crucial role in the leadership, coaching and personnel development of other members on the team. They foster a culture of respect and collaboration among the team towards achieving solutions. They also perform "learning reviews" ("Just Culture") of incidents to ensure we are always learning and improving.



  • Data Analysis


  • Design and build modern data pipelines and data streams as per service needs.
  • Using the full end to end Microsoft Stack to deliver data solutions for UL Hospitals.
  • An ability to understanding complex data challenges and derive solutions.
  • Design, build and maintain a variety of different data storage solutions such as relational databases, non-relational databases, data lakes etc.
  • Use of programming languages to perform complex queries of data stored.
  • Developing, running, and quality checking reports for various systems.
  • Work with stakeholders towards improving data capture and quality.
  • Translate functional specifications and business requirements into architectural designs that include complex data models.
  • Create and maintain documentations for developed solutions.
  • Analyse current business practices, processes and procedures to identify future opportunities for leveraging Microsoft Azure data & analytics PaaS services.
  • Contribute to and enforce governance, standards and best practise within the Data Services team and the wider organisation.
